What is 5 percent off 10.99 Dollars
The easiest way of calculating discount is, in this case, to multiply the normal price $10.99 by 5 then divide it by one hundred. So, the discount equals $0.55. To calculate the sales price, simply deduct the discount of $0.55 from the original price $10.99 then get $10.44 as the sales price.

1) What is 5 percent (%) off $10.99?
Using the formula one and replacing the given values:
Amount Saved = Original Price x Discount % / 100. So,
Amount Saved = 10.99 x 5 / 100
Amount Saved = 54.95 / 100
Amount Saved = $0.55 (answer)
In other words, a 5% discount for an item with the original price of $10.99 is equal to $0.5495 (Amount Saved).
Note that to find the amount saved, just multiply it by the percentage and divide by 100.
You may have received a promotional code for a 5 percent of discount. If the price is $10.99, what is the sales price:
2) How much do you pay for an item of $10.99 when discounted 5 percent (%)? What is the item's sale price?
Using the formula two and replacing the given values:
Sale Price = Original Price - Amount Saved. So,
Sale Price = 10.99 - 0.5495
Sale Price = $10.44 (answer)
This means the cost of the item to you is $10.44.
You will pay $10.44 for an item with an original price of $10.99 when discounted by 5%. In other words, if you buy an item at $10.99 with a 5% discount, you pay $10.99 - 0.5495 = $10.44
